The École Francophone Antoine de Saint-Exupéry (EFASE) or École Antoine de Saint-Exupéry de Kigali, also known as the Kigali French School, is a school in downtown Kigali, Rwanda. [1] The school, with a capacity of 400 students, [ 2 ] serves nursery ( maternelle ) to upper secondary ( lycée ) levels.

The African School of Governance (ASG) is a graduate institution launched on 16 October 2024, with its campus located in Kigali, Rwanda. It was established to offer world-class graduate programmes in policy, research, governance, leadership, and management , aimed at developing future leaders on the African continent.
Our Mother of Mercy Catholic School opened in fall 1930 [11] or fall 1931, [12] and closed in Spring 2009. [13] When it opened it served grades 1–12. [12] The initial teaching force was the New Orleans–based Sisters of the Holy Family. [11] The school was consolidated with the St. Francis of Assisi School.

The École Belge de Kigali (EBK, "Belgian School of Kigali") is an International school in Kigali, Rwanda. The school follows the curriculum defined by the Federation Wallonie-Bruxelles of Belgium (French speaking community) The school offers (pre-)kindergarten, elementary school and secondary school (ISCED level 0 to 3).
